Description:
Remington US Model 1903-A3, manufactured January 1943, serial number 33593xx. Remington 4-groove barrel dated Dec 1942. All marked parts are Remington. No import marks.

Part Details:
-Receiver: January 1943, excellent condition, absolutely no pitting. Finish appears original (although we can’t prove that) and is in excellent condition, worn only where the bolt slides. Has the green color associated with long term storage in cosmolene.
-Barrel: marked “RA 12-42” with flaming bomb/proof punch mark, also proof mark “P”. Greenish parkerized finish in excellent condition. 4-groove rifling. Bore is bright, good riflings, crown excellent. ME = 1, TE = 3
-Trigger guard: 1903A3 type, marked “R”. Shows some finish wear and some pitting on the sides, not visible when assembled
-Follower: 1903A3 type, marked “R”
-Follower spring: marked “R”
-Stacking swivel: marked “R”
-Barrel band: swivel marked “R”
-Barrel band spring: stamped 1903A3 type, marked “R”
-Bayonet lug: marked “R”
-Handguard ring: marked “R”
-Buttplate: small Remington checkering pattern, very good condition
-Trigger: smooth 1903 type, marked “R”
-Sear: marked “R”
-Bolt: marked “R” under handle, parkerized with large gas port
-Bolt sleeve: blued, marked “R”
-Extractor collar: A3 stamped type, marked “R”
-Safety: READY and SAFE in block letters, marked “R” on edge
-Striker: marked “R”
-Firing pin: marked “R”, blued
-Extractor: appears to be black oxide, no gas port, marked “R”
-Ejector: marked “R”
-Magazine cutoff: marked “R” on sleeve, ON/OFF in serif lettering
-Rear sight: ramp marked “R”, blued, base blued and marked “R”
-Front sight: base and blade unmarked
-Stock: straight, walnut, Remington, has 7/16” circled “P” behind trigger guard, also marked “77” in the same area, “FJA” with crossed cannons on the left side, the usual assembly marks in front of the trigger guard. Two recoil bolts, no cracks, significant number of dings/scratches, but serviceable
-Handguard: walnut, good color match to stock, dinged up but no cracks
